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47284845 50579742932 93559320 079408097 42100
22717 91 79930617981
22717 91 79930617981
53038 183615 6119851
All about undefined
Interested in learning more?
22717 91 79930617981
53038 183615 6119851
See more
5214709 61518 0339939
35127 99814 923 8692146 7934411
See more
5028188 06
92629 8852320 39574110771
See more